Having written and produced with Burna Boy, Samini and Dappy, SS has been a creative musical genius amongst some of the biggest names in music of recent times. Stepping out to his own records over the last year including joints such as ‘Gasonlina’, ‘Late Nights’ and ‘How I Stay’, the young music prodigy is becoming the name on everyone’s lips as the heat starts bubbling around him and eyes are flickering in his direction.
Dropping his latest track ‘Best Life’, the track is pumped with thick bass, hip-hop energy and a blend of lo-fi, a sound becoming synonymous to SS. The syncretic and dark vibe is unmistakably mixed with his melodic and soulful high-pitched ad-libs and the laid-back yet confident delivery that he showers across the beat.
From the track to the visuals and artwork, the clarity of the SS brand is audible without a hint of desperation. This is pure, unadulterated vibes as the young music boss captures everything about what it is right now to stand out, and he does it with defined clarity and confidence.
